I have had my empeg for over 3 months now and it still does not work in my car. It works perfectly fine and the trouble has been with installation and the numbnuts that call themselves experts in my area... I will give my moral first, you can read the story if you are further interested....

moral: CAN NOT ADD EMPEG TO CHEVY FACTORY SYSTEM BY HARDWIRE...

One sunny day in 2002, happy go lucky myself went out and purchased a 2002 Chevy Tahoe. Extremely happy with my purchase, I wanted to upgrade the factory system and add an empeg to play my library of MP3s. Behold!!! the factory system actually sounds pretty damned good. I did some preliminary investigation and found that there were 3rd party companies who made adapters to add rca outputs to the factory system via the CD changer connector on the back of the unit (peripheral electronics - junk!). Talking to my local stereo installer who agreed, purchased the ONSTAR adapter, the cd changer adapter and had it all installed, cutting the center console to install my newly shiney empeg. Picked the car up and Alternator Whine!!! returned the car and the installer could find no wrong, called Peripheral and found that the factory system does not work with their adapters... Solution provided by installer??? Buy a new head unit, preferably Alpine.

Fine! bought the Chevy sized Alpine unit with the AiNet input. Installer states $20 adapter will be necessary for input of empeg RCA outputs... Calls back and states the Alpine Chevy sized head unit does not have versalink... now will need $80 adapter... Fine... installs and calls again... versalink adapter requires CD changer to work... #?!@!!! I purchased CD changer and now there are concerns with 4v outputs vs. Alpine versalink RCA input 850mv maximums... #!@ again....

To this day, no MP3s yet...

Moral again? Do your homework... I am taking suggestions for all who can wake me from my nightmare....
